Nestled in the heart of England, Worcestershire Parkway Train Station serves as a pivotal transport hub in the West Midlands. Opened relatively recently in February 2020, this modern station was designed to ease transport connectivity within the northwest-southeast mainline axis and improve access to rail services for the surrounding county. With its strategic location and excellent facilities, Worcestershire Parkway is an ideal choice for local commuters and travelers bound for various destinations across the UK.
When you step into Worcestershire Parkway, you'll immediately notice its focus on accessibility and convenience. The station features step-free access throughout, ensuring it is welcoming to all travelers. Ticketing options are flexible, offering both a staffed ticket office and user-friendly machines, including accessible ones. Although waiting room facilities are absent, there is ample seating available for a comfortable wait.
Additional services include helpful staff at the ticket office and customer help points, who are ready to assist from early morning till late evening. CCTV coverage assures safety, while free parking for blue badge holders emphasizes inclusive services. For cyclists, there are 52 cycling spaces equipped with CCTV, ensuring security for those commuting on two wheels.

Shoreditch High Street train station is designed to accommodate the modern traveler's needs while retaining an element of simplicity. The ticket office operates mainly in the mornings, but don't worry if you’re an afternoon traveler as ticket machines are available for purchasing tickets and collecting those bought online. Both accessible ticket machines and induction loops are provided to ensure convenience for all passengers.
While the station itself doesn’t offer extensive lounge facilities or luggage storage, the existence of CCTV ensures a measure of safety. For those with mobility needs, there is step-free access throughout the station, accessible ticket barriers, toilets, and even ramps for train access. Unfortunately, there is no parking, but with Shoreditch being a hub of public transport, who needs a car anyway?
You’ll also find refreshments at the station including a coffee kiosk and vending machines for both food and cold drinks, as well as a few high-street shops. Though you'll need to head into the locale for an ATM or currency exchange, which gives you another perfect excuse to explore all Shoreditch has to offer.
One of the joys of Shoreditch High Street station lies in its convenient transport links. If buses are your go-to, rail replacement services operate via Bethnal Green Road at stops J and K. If you prefer the Underground, Liverpool Street is a leisurely 15-minute walk away, or just a single stop to Whitechapel, southbound on the train.
